Instructions
1. Chop the Peppers: Begin by finely chopping the red bell pepper and jalapeños or poblano pepper.
2. Prep the Cream Cheese: In a mixer or with a hand-held mixing tool, cream the Neufchatel cheese until it reaches a smooth texture.
3. Incorporate Additional Dairy: Add the nonfat Greek yogurt and ranch dip mix to the creamy cheese base. Mix until well-integrated but refrain from overmixing to keep the creamy texture intact.
4. Fold in the Goodness: Delicately fold in the chopped peppers, canned corn, and optionally, the sliced olives.
5. Serve It Up: The dip is best served with an array of fresh vegetables, crackers, chips, or even sliced French bread.
Notes
Ranch Dip Mix Substitute: If you don’t have ranch dip mix at hand, you can easily create a substitute by combining 1/2 to 1 teaspoon of both onion powder and garlic powder, with 1 tablespoon of dried parsley.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
